On my way to the first job this morning and stopped at a regular parking spot to have a coffee as running a bit early.

This is Rhos on Sea, a town on the North wales Coast.

The coast of North Wales has been prone to flooding in the past and with climate change they are working now to hopefully avoid major flooding in the future.

It hasmade a major mess of promenade and terrible traffic issues during the summer but hopefully once done things can get back to normal.
